Bulgarian Naval Academy Acquires VSTEP Simulators

On the 6th of August 2016, the official opening ceremony for The Centre for Integrated Management and Monitoring of the Coastal Zone was inaugurated by Mr. Boyko Borisov, the Prime Minister of Bulgaria. At the opening ceremony were present the Rector of the Academy, Commodore Prof. DSc Boyan Mednikarov and Deputy Chief of Educational and Scientific Activities, Captain Prof. Dr Kalin Kalinov. Among the official guests were parliament members from the Bulgarian government, representatives of other Bulgarian authorities, members of the military, ambassadors and representatives of the maritime industry. VSTEP Appoint New Head of Sales

International developer of simulators and virtual training software, Rotterdam-based VSTEP, says it has appointed Joost van Ree as head of sales with responsibility for worldwide sales and growth of the company’s simulator products. Van Ree will be heading up the company’s global sales force for all its simulator products, including the NAUTIS maritime simulator and RescueSim Incident Command departments. VSTEP adds that Joost van Ree brings a career of over 10 years in Senior Sales, Business Development and Management positions with a maritime background to the company. He will also lead further expansion of the global sales & business development team and the VSTEP partner network.
